From all accounts he's been asked to take an interim managerial role with a responsibility of auditing the team and the club to an extent, with the aim of later moving upstairs.

Ralf has continually said he's given feedback to the board regarding the squad and by the looks of the performances it would seem that most of the squad don’t like what he's said. The cushy times are all but over and the players are having to deal with the harsh reality of no longer having all the power. Ralf's been pretty open about United's poor recruitment and how all these players don't fit any one system, which mean's they have to go, so a bunch of them probably feel unfairly targeted for reasons out of their control.

All this accumulates in the current state of joint apathy we have at the club, and if this wasn't the case one of the players agents would have called him out by now.
